About our team/Mō te tīma

The Centre for Adverse Reactions Monitoring (CARM) operates New Zealand’s voluntary adverse reactions reporting programme for medicines and vaccines as well as adverse events to natural health products and medicinal cannabis. 

CARM's activities which are funded under contract to the Ministry of Health, operate alongside other research initiatives and programmes to make up the New Zealand Pharmacovigilance Centre (NZPhvC), supporting an integral part of New Zealand's pharmacovigilance activities. 

CARM works closely with Medsafe, the Ministry of Health, the health sector and academia.

The role/Te mahi

This opportunity could suit a practicing clinician seeking career diversity.

As a Medical Assessor, you will be able to apply your clinical knowledge of medicine and pharmacology/vaccinology to reviewing clinical reports of adverse events to determine the likelihood of any causal association. This forms part of the report record in our national database and underpins pharmacovigilance. 

Your contribution to these pharmacovigilance activities through individual report review or database analysis, will support identifying events, or patterns of events of concern that may inform regulatory action, prescribing advice or education.
